#51fc6c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#51fc6c is composed of 31.8% red, 98.8% green and 42.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 57.1%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 129.5 degrees, a saturation of 96.6% and a lightness of 65.3%. #51fc6c color hex could be obtained by blending #a2ffd8 with #00f900.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

#51fc6c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#51fc6c has RGB values of R:81, G:252, B:108 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0, Y:0.57,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 5373036.

Shades and Tints of #51fc6c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#001303 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#51fc6c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a3aaa4 is the less saturated color, while #51fc6c is the most saturated one.
